Opportunity Overview:

Become a vital part of our healthcare community in Central Alberta, where you will have the chance to significantly impact patient outcomes. As a casual pharmacist within Central Zone South, you will work collaboratively with clients, physicians, and a multidisciplinary team to enhance patient care. Central Zone South Pharmacy serves 15 rural hospitals and care facilities, providing a diverse range of services including acute care, surgical interventions, palliative support, and ongoing care. Your primary location will be at a facility that focuses on general medicine and continuing care, with the flexibility to cover additional sites as needed. Training will be provided at each location to ensure you are well-prepared for your responsibilities. Our environment fosters teamwork, with pharmacists playing an essential role in the healthcare team across all sites. The pharmacy team is supported by dedicated pharmacy technicians and assistants, all striving to operate within their full scope of practice. If you are a pharmacist eager to engage with patients and contribute to a thriving healthcare environment, we encourage you to consider this opportunity. Location and start date are negotiable.

Role Responsibilities:

In the role of Pharmacist I, you will oversee the safe, effective, and efficient preparation and distribution of pharmaceutical services. Your responsibilities will include managing medication therapy for patients, both at the outset and on an ongoing basis. You will also be tasked with assessing, intervening, and resolving any potential or actual drug-related issues, in addition to supervising activities related to compounding and packaging medications.
